Dude how did you hook up that shift light?
Reply
Old Jun 2, 2010 | 08:33 PM
  #88  
Phantom's Avatar
Thread Starter
11 Second Club
15 Year Member
iTrader: (16)
 
Joined: Sep 2006
Posts: 5,694
Likes: 50
From: The 405
Default

this particular shift lite just has a power, ground and tach wire. power and ground are obviously self explanatory, and the green tach wire went to pin10 on the green connector of the pcm(white wire) and then set it to 4cyl on the lite
